In a tightly contested National League South clash between Hemel Hempstead Town and Maidstone United FC, both sides exhibited solid defensive capabilities, ultimately sharing the spoils with a 1-1 draw. Hemel Hempstead took the lead early on, capitalizing on one of their limited chances, which registered as just one shot on target from their total attempts. Their efficiency in converting chances, albeit limited, shows their ability to maximize the opportunities presented, though it also highlights an area needing improvement in creating and converting more chances.
Maidstone United FC responded resiliently, managing to equalize through sustained pressure. They registered a higher number of shots on target, demonstrating their attacking intent and capability to test Hemel Hempstead's goalkeeper consistently. The away team's ability to create chances pointed to a structured offensive approach but missed a few more key opportunities that could have swayed the game further in their favor. This spurt illustrated their attacking depth but also underlined the need for better composure in finishing.
Set-pieces played a notable role in the dynamics of the game, given the number of corner kicks Maidstone United earned. However, they failed to convert these into more goals, which might suggest room for improvement in their set-piece strategy. Despite both teams maintaining discipline with no red or yellow cards, the match was marked by numerous fouls that interrupted the flow, possibly contributing to neither side being able to gain full control. The equal share of points reflected a balanced encounter where both teams could take positives away, predominantly in their defensive solidity, yet both need to enhance their offensive precision for future matches.
